In demanding settings such as prisons, psychiatric facilities, and residential homes, safety is paramount. Regular clocks can pose a risk if individuals seek to manipulate them for harmful purposes. To address this problem, specialized ligature-resistant safety clocks have emerged. These advanced timepieces are designed with strong components to resist tampering. They often feature design elements such as recessed surfaces, shatterproof glass, and secure mounting arrangements. By minimizing the risk of self-harm incidents, these clocks contribute to a safer and more protected environment.
